1.  Donations Irrevocable. National School Chaplain Association is a recognized 501(c)(3) not-for-profit organization. Therefore, Tax-deductible contributions must be irrevocable; therefore, all donations and trainings are nonrefundable and nontransferable.

3. Deputized Fundraising. National School Chaplain Association utilizes the accepted practice called “deputized fundraising” to raise donations to support many of our activities. Individuals who desire to join NSCA staff or to be involved in other projects, programs, or activities, become fundraisers for NSCA with the mutual intention of participating under NSCA’s direction in carrying out the purpose(s) for which they are appealing for donations. It is acceptable practice to agree on and monitor success toward individual and project fundraising goals. However, as the qualified “charity,” NSCA must maintain discretion and control over the use of all tax-deductible contributions without any obligation to directly benefit the fundraiser or any other individual.

2. Unrestricted and Restricted Donations. National School Chaplain Association (NSCA) gratefully accepts contributions to support our overall ministry and also recognizes the desire by some donors for NSCA to restrict the use of their donations to specified purposes. Restricted donations are used to support the purpose for which they were originally intended until that purpose has been satisfied. After which, any excess funds are used to further the ministries of NSCA.

5. Reporting to Donors. Donors will receive acknowledgements during the year confirming the amounts and dates of gifts as well as calendar year-end tax receipts documenting such gifts as deductible contributions for income tax purposes in the United States. Each donor is advised to consult his or her personal income tax advisor for the applicability of such contributions in his or her own circumstances.
